Joining as a Society

We welcome societies and groups dedicated to the arts to join us and become part of the Hillingdon Arts Association. Membership provides opportunities to connect, promote your activities, and enhance the arts in our community.

Membership Categories

  • Society Membership: Open to societies and groups engaging in artistic, cultural, or educational activities. Membership fees are £20 per annum.

Membership Benefits

As a member, your society will receive:

  • Regular updates via emails and newsletters.
  • Invitations to events and meetings.
  • Opportunities to feature your activities on our website and in our “What’s On” leaflets—free of charge.

Applying for Personal Membership

You can become a paid member as an individual, or simply subscribe to our newsletter to stay up to date with the latest HAA events, groups, and news.

Full Membership

You will get everything in the free membership, plus:

  • You can vote at meetings
  • List your events & classes free of charge on our website and in our What’s On leaflets*.

Membership fee for full members is £12 per year.

Newsletter (Free)

You will receive emails, newsletters, and other information about the ARTS in this area. You will also be sent details of meetings and able to attend them, but cannot vote.
